PRIMARY PURPOSE:  To provide third-party underwriting services and be responsible for performing captive underwriting comprised of property/casualty including workers’ compensation lines of business with account premiums ranging from $25,000 - $2,000,000 in premium.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S and RESPONSIBILITIES
-Maintains strong relationships with agents, brokers, carrier contacts and internal department personnel.
-Evaluates the risks and exposures associated with underwriting a book of business including developing new and renewal business quote proposals, developing loss picks, maintaining logs, preparing premium finance agreements, reviewing audits, working with internal accounting and captive management teams for billing and collections of premiums, providing summaries and projections of payroll reports provided by clients, accurately performing exposure based analysis using carrier rating models, submitting documents, communicating and negotiating pricing and coverages with carrier underwriters and communicating and supporting those decisions to brokers, carrier underwriters and  ARS Management.
-Works with claims and risk control teams to assist in any program service issues.
-Assists in the development and administration of complex underwriting rules and guidelines.
-Analyzes quantitative and qualitative data to improve risk selection.
-Acts as a technical resource for property and casualty coverage lines of business.
-Develops and maintains strong external/internal customer relationships by identifying, anticipating business needs and by delivering timely responses to captive customers, brokers and ARS managers; assists business development with marketing information, presentations and related activities.
-Mentors underwriting staff.
-Participates in special projects as assigned.
-Meets underwriting department KPI’s (key performance indicators) established by ARS Management.
